RC4 - be sure to set up your database for Std version

Hopefully this will prevent some of you doing what I did this morning :-)

I have installed RC4 (actually, did a software upgrade using the Installation Manager from RC3) and forgot to edit the teamserver.properties files to point to the correct database. This is clearly stated in the installation instructions - so user error on my part.

However, in spite of not pointing to a valid database, I could use the webUI to create users, a project, etc. The only problem occurred when I was using the RTC Eclipse client and I started getting errors about not connecting to the database.

The fix is to go back in and correct the teamserver.properties file. This will mean you lose any settings you have entered so far (I did not try and recover these as I am working on a test repository and had nothing worth keeping). Also - start up RTC in a new workspace, don't use the existing workspace as it seems to retain some info on the connection.

Quick correction - I have seen that Derby is now supported in Standard. I missed this change on RC4.
